Output 38858a1148126650ed9366f4215fdd34b8c016dc61118bb8fe4493748957f2f9:0

value
2295682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6439e65fc0be647604dc6b21989632e57f825a5 OP_EQUAL
address
3KmLiky2nkzMDTWArjKM9XXQCJDYENPWTr
transaction
38858a1148126650ed9366f4215fdd34b8c016dc61118bb8fe4493748957f2f9
spent
true